An important decision was made concerning 202 thousand elderly citizens in public transportation in Bursa. In line with the decision taken by the Provincial Hygiene Board, citizens over the age of 65 have ceased to benefit from free public transportation during prohibited hours, within the framework of corona virus measures.

With the decision of the Bursa Provincial Hygiene Board, a curfew was imposed at certain hours over the age of 65 in Bursa. Within the framework of this restriction, people over the age of 65 were also prohibited from using public transportation. In line with this decision, with the software change made by Burulaş, the elderly will not be able to use public transportation during these hours.
